Medicare Principles Explained

Original Medicare is offered by the US government to folks who are over age 65 or under 65 and on disability. Medicare is made up of Parts A and B. Part A covers hospital insurance and Part B covers doctor visits and outpatient services. Generally, Medicare covers 80% of the bill so there’s 20% left combined with various deductibles copays and coinsurances. Due to these gaps left over many folks decide to get a Medicare Supplement Plan to cover what Medicare does not fully pay for, these programs are also referred to as Medigap plans.

Medicare Supplement Outline

There are 10 standardized Medicare supplement plans available. The hottest Medicare supplement plans are plans F, G, & N. Because the plans are all standardized and the advantages are regulated by the US government there’s no difference in coverage between companies for the exact same plan. For instance, Plan G is exactly the same if it’s provided by Mutual of Omaha, Aetna, Cigna, or some other insurance company. In any particular state from the U.S. you will find about 30 or more companies offering these programs, each in a different price.

With any standardized Medigap plan you can visit any doctor anywhere in the nation that takes Medicare, no referrals needed. Also plans F, N and G have a limited foreign travel coverage that’s useful for those folks May travel outside of the country.

Also, it is essential to be aware that prescription coverage isn’t provided on any standardized Medicare Supplement Plan, it’s covered under a separate plan known as part D.

These plans are also guaranteed-renewable for life, premiums can’t be increased as a result of health or canceled as a result of health.

What Plan To Select?

Deciding what plan to select can be quite confusing. There are approximately 10 plans available but the most well-known ones are F, G and N. Plan G tends to be the most cost-effective option, Plan F is the most comprehensive, and plan N as a great alternative option for those who don’t go to the doctor very often.

Medigap Insurance Plan F

Medicare Supplement Plan F is the most comprehensive of Medicare supplement plans and also the priciest. Coverage is fairly straightforward, this program covers everything Medicare does not totally cover, like the 20% and most of deductibles copays and coinsurances. With a Plan F, you should never have a health bill, as long as the services that you receive are approved by Medicare.

Supplemental Plan G

Medicare supplement plan G has become the most popular plan in 2021. Medigap plan G is considered the most cost-effective plan compared to using the other Medicare supplement programs available. This plan is very similar to Plan F, it covers 100 percent of all except for the part B deductible which is not insured and that deductible is $203 in 2021.

The reason plan G is considered the most cost-effective plan is because compared against Plan F, the amount of money that you save in premium is greater than the difference, which is (amount) in (year). Also, the rate increases on average, historically are somewhat less on Plan G compared to Plan F. In addition, Plan F isn’t going to be offered following 2022 to individuals turning 65 and that will likely cause the prices to go up over they have gone up in the past. Another reason Plan G a far better long-term option.

Medicare Supplement Plan N

Plan N is comparable to insurance plan G, except the following out-of-pocket expenditures on insurance N:

$0-$20 office visit copay
$50 at the emergency room (waived if admitted)
Part B excess charges are not covered

Plan N is a possible great match for someone who doesn’t see the doctor on a regular basis, this person would not incur the office visit copay every time they see the physician. If you’re looking to save a little premium dollars Plan N may be fantastic match for you.
